The burden of hepatitis E in Southeast Asia is substantial, influenced by its distinct socio-economic and environmental factors, as well as variations in healthcare systems. The aim of this study was to assess the pooled seroprevalence of hepatitis E across countries within the Southeast Asian region by the UN division.The study analyzed 66 papers across PubMed, Web of Science, and Scopus databases, encompassing data from of 44,850 individuals focusing on anti-HEV seroprevalence. The investigation spanned nine countries, excluding Brunei and East Timor due to lack of data. The pooled prevalence of anti-HEV IgG was determined to be 21.03%, with the highest prevalence observed in Myanmar (33.46%) and the lowest in Malaysia (5.93%). IgM prevalence was highest in Indonesia (12.43%) and lowest in Malaysia (0.91%). The study stratified populations into high-risk (farm workers, chronic patients) and low-risk groups (general population, blood donors, pregnant women, hospital patients). It revealed a higher IgG-28.9%, IgM-4.42% prevalence in the former group, while the latter group exhibited figures of 17.86% and 3.15%, respectively, indicating occupational and health-related vulnerabilities to HEV.A temporal analysis (1987-2023), indicated an upward trend in both IgG and IgM prevalence, suggesting an escalating HEV burden.These findings contribute to a better understanding of HEV seroprevalence in Southeast Asia, shedding light on important public health implications and suggesting directions for further research and intervention strategies.Key pointsResearch QuestionInvestigate the seroprevalence of hepatitis E virus (HEV) in Southeast Asian countries focusing on different patterns, timelines, and population cohorts.FindingsSporadic Transmission of IgG and IgM Prevalence:• Pooled anti-HEV IgG prevalence: 21.03%• Pooled anti-HEV IgM prevalence: 3.49%Seroprevalence among specific groups:High-risk group (farm workers and chronic patients):• anti-HEV IgG: 28.9%• anti-HEV IgM: 4.42%Low-risk group (general population, blood donors, pregnant women, hospital patients):• anti-HEV IgG: 17.86%• anti-HEV IgM: 3.15%Temporal Seroprevalence of HEV:Anti-HEV IgG prevalence increased over decades (1987-1999; 2000-2010; 2011-2023): 12.47%, 18.43%, 29.17% as an anti-HEV IgM prevalence: 1.92%, 2.44%, 5.27%ImportanceProvides a comprehensive overview of HEV seroprevalence in Southeast Asia.Highlights variation in seroprevalence among different population groups.Reveals increasing trend in HEV seroprevalence over the years.Distinguishes between sporadic and epidemic cases for a better understanding of transmission dynamics.

BACKGROUND: In countries with intermediate or high hepatitis B virus (HBV) endemicity, mother-to-child transmission (MTCT) represents the main route of chronic HBV infection. There is a paucity of information on HBV MTCT in Cambodia. This study aimed to investigate the prevalence of HBV infection among pregnant women and its MTCT rate in Siem Reap, Cambodia. METHODS: This longitudinal study included two parts, study-1 to screen HBsAg among pregnant women and study-2 to follow up babies of all HBsAg-positive and one-fourth of HBsAg-negative mothers at their delivery and six-month post-partum. Serum or dried blood spot (DBS) samples were collected to examine HBV sero-markers by chemiluminescent enzyme immunoassay (CLEIA), and molecular analyses were performed on HBsAg-positive samples. Structured questionnaires and medical records were used to examine the risk factors for HBV infection. MTCT rate was calculated by HBsAg positivity of 6-month-old babies born to HBsAg-positive mothers and ascertained by the homology of HBV genomes in mother-child pair at 6-month-old. RESULTS: A total of 1,565 pregnant women were screened, and HBsAg prevalence was 4.28% (67/1565). HBeAg positivity was 41.8% and was significantly associated with high viral load (p < 0.0001). Excluding subjects who dropped out due to restrictions during COVID-19, one out of 35 babies born to HBsAg-positive mothers tested positive for HBsAg at 6 months of age, despite receiving timely HepB birth dose and HBIG, followed by 3 doses of HepB vaccine. Hence the MTCT rate was 2.86%. The mother of the infected baby was positive for HBeAg and had a high HBV viral load (1.2 × 109 copies/mL). HBV genome analysis showed 100% homology between the mother and the child. CONCLUSIONS: Our findings illustrate the intermediate endemicity of HBV infection among pregnant women in Siem Reap, Cambodia. Despite full HepB vaccination, a residual risk of HBV MTCT was observed. This finding supports the recently updated guidelines for the prevention of HBV MTCT in 2021, which integrated screening and antiviral prophylaxis for pregnant women at risk of HBV MTCT. Furthermore, we strongly recommend the urgent implementation of these guidelines nationwide to effectively combat HBV in Cambodia.

AIM: This study aimed to assess the effect of COVID-19 on hepatitis-related services in Bangladesh and compared the situation with same study conducted in Japan and globally. METHODS: We conducted an online cross-sectional questionnaire survey among the clinicians of four societies associated with liver disease in Bangladesh from October to December 2022. The questionnaire included the same questions as a survey conducted in Japan and globally. RESULTS: A total of 83 clinicians from 8 divisions in Bangladesh participated; 66.3% were heads of departments/institutions. Except for HCV treatment initiation, more than 30% of clinicians reported a 76-99% decline in all services. Compared to Japan and the global survey, there was a significantly higher decline in all HBV and HCV services in Bangladesh. To resume services back to pre-COVID-19 levels, Patient anxiety and fear (Bangladesh Survey: 80.7% vs Japan Survey: 67.4% vs Global Survey: 37.9%, p < 0.0001), loss of space due to COVID-19 (Bangladesh Survey: 63.9% vs Japan Survey: 34.7% vs Global Survey: 19.4%, p < 0.0001) were the main challenges. As part of the mitigation strategy, usage of telemedicine (Bangladesh Survey: 83.1% vs. Japan Survey: 67.3% vs Global Survey: 78.6% p < 0.0001), COVID-19 benefits, such as increased laboratory testing platforms (Bangladesh Survey: 77.1% vs Japan Survey: 17.9% vs Global Survey: 41.8%, p < 0.0001) was reported significantly higher in Bangladesh than in Japan and global survey. CONCLUSION: All the services-related to HBV and HCV were highly affected during greatest impact month of COVID-19 in Bangladesh and the decline level was higher than Japan and global survey. Repeated countermeasures of COVID-19 and constrained healthcare-system were the probable reasons in Bangladesh. Positive impact resulting from COVID-19 countermeasures should be utilized in the national hepatitis program in Bangladesh.

Sever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) viral load dynamics in respiratory samples have been studied, but knowledge about changes in serial serum samples of infected patients in relation to their immunological response is lacking. We investigated the dynamics of SARS-CoV-2 viral load and antibody response in sequential serum of coronavirus disease 2019 (COVID-19) patients and attempted to culture the virus in the serum. A total of 81 sequential serum samples from 10 confirmed COVID-19 patients (5 with mild and 5 with moderate symptoms) were analyzed. Samples were collected during hospitalization and after discharge (median follow-up of 35 days). SARS-CoV-2 ribonucleic acid in the serum was detected by real-time polymerase chain reaction. Total antibody and IgG to SARS-CoV-2 Spike protein were analyzed by Chemiluminescent Immunoassays, and neutralizing antibodies were detected using a Surrogate Virus Neutralization Test. Viremia was observed in all cases at admission, and viral copy gradually dropped to undetectable levels in patients with mild symptoms but fluctuated and remained persistent in moderate cases. The viral culture of samples with the highest viral load for each patient did not show any cytopathic change. The antibody response was faster and higher in moderate cases. This study provides a basic clue for infectious severity-dependent immune response, viremia, and antibody acquisition pattern.

BACKGROUND: Fatty liver is frequently found in a general population, and it is critical to detect advanced fibrosis. FIB-4 index is considered a useful marker for evaluating liver fibrosis but the distribution of FIB-4 index in the general population remains unknown. METHODS: This cross-sectional study included residents who underwent ultrasonography at health checkups in Hiroshima or Iwate prefectures. The distribution of FIB-4 index in the total study population (N = 75,666) as well as in non-alcoholic fatty liver disease (NAFLD) populations (N = 17,968) and non-drinkers without fatty liver populations (N = 47,222) was evaluated. The distribution of aspartate aminotransferase (AST) levels, alanine aminotransferase (ALT) levels was also evaluated. RESULTS: The mean FIB-4 index in the total study population was 1.20 ± 0.63. FIB-4 index ≥ 2.67, which indicates a high risk of liver fibrosis, was found in 16.4% of those aged ≥ 70 years. In the NAFLD population, 58.1% of those in their 60 s and 88.1% of those ≥ 70 years met the criteria for referral to hepatologists by using the recommended FIB-4 index cutoff value (≥ 1.3). The mean FIB-4 index in the NAFLD population (1.12 ± 0.58) was significantly lower than in the non-drinkers without fatty liver (1.23 ± 0.63, p < 0.0001). The non-drinkers without fatty liver tended to have higher AST relative to ALT levels (60.0% with AST/ALT > 1.0), whereas the results in the NAFLD population were opposite (14.8% with AST/ALT > 1.0). AST > ALT resulted in a higher FIB-4 index in non-drinkers without fatty liver due to the nature of FIB-4 index formula. CONCLUSIONS: The cutoff value of FIB-4 index (≥ 1.3) for triaging the elderly people with fatty liver for referral to hepatologists should be reconsidered to avoid over-referral. Due to the impact of age and characteristics of AST/ALT ratios, there is no prospect of using FIB-4 index for primary screening for liver fibrosis in a general population of unknown presence or absence of liver disease, even though it can be easily calculated using routine clinical indices. It is desired to develop a non-invasive method for picking up cases with advanced fibrosis latent in the general population.

AIM: Achieving hepatitis B virus (HBV) and hepatitis C virus (HCV) elimination requires continuous and sustained high volumes of diagnosis and treatment, which have been affected by the ongoing COVID-19 pandemic. This study assessed the effects of COVID-19 on hepatitis-related services in Japan and compared Japan's situation with a global survey. METHODS: We conducted an online cross-sectional questionnaire survey of hepatologists from the Japan Society of Hepatology from August to October 2021 by using the same questionnaire from which a survey was conducted globally to address the effects of COVID-19 on hepatitis-related services. Hepatologists responded based on own impressions of their affiliated institutions. RESULTS: In total, 196 hepatologists participated from 35 prefectures including 49.5% in managerial positions. Approximately 40% survey participants reported a 1%-25% decline in HBV and HCV screening and confirmatory testing. In addition, 53.6% and 45.4% reported no decline in HBV and HCV treatment initiation, respectively. Comparing any level of decrease with the global survey, there was less of a decline observed in Japan for screening (HBV: 51% vs. 56.3%, HCV: 51% vs. 70.9%) and treatment initiation (HBV: 32.7% vs. 52.4%, HCV: 41.8% vs. 66%). However, patient anxiety/fear (67.4%) and loss of staff due to COVID-19 (49.0%) were reported as challenges for resuming services to pre-COVID-19 levels. CONCLUSION: Although in Japan all-inclusive decline in HBV- and HCV-related services were lower than in other countries, a greater decline was observed in HBV and HCV screening and diagnosis than in treatment initiation. Prolonged anxiety/fear among patients, and loss of staff and facilities from the COVID-19 response activities must be addressed to achieve elimination of hepatitis by 2030.

AIM: Fatty liver is the most common liver disease. This study examined fatty liver and advanced fibrosis prevalence in a random sample of the Japanese general population. METHODS: A total of 6000 people randomly selected from two cities in Hiroshima Prefecture were invited to participate in this cross-sectional study originally carried out for hepatitis virus screening. Ultrasonography and FibroScan (controlled attenuation parameter [CAP] and liver stiffness measurement [LSM]) were provided as additional tests. RESULTS: Of 6000 invited individuals, 1043 participated in hepatitis virus screening, of which 488 randomly selected individuals (median age, 56 years; interquartile range, 45-68 years; male participants, 49.8%) underwent ultrasonography, CAP, and LSM. Ultrasonography showed fatty liver in 24.6% and mild fatty liver in 32.8%. Controlled attenuation parameter showed severe steatosis in 27.5%, moderate steatosis in 12.5%, and mild steatosis in 11.1%. Overall, 62.1% were diagnosed with fatty liver based on ultrasonography or CAP. Nonalcoholic fatty liver disease (NAFLD) prevalence was 50.6%. Liver stiffness measurement found cirrhosis in 1.0% and severe fibrosis in 1.8%. Multivariate analysis of risk factors associated with ≥F2 or higher liver fibrosis showed that age ≥60 years and above (adjusted odds ratio [AOR], 3.2; 95% confidence interval [CI], 1.5-6.9; p = 0.0031), hepatitis C virus antibody positivity (AOR, 8.4; 95% CI, 1.0-68.4; p = 0.0467), and fatty liver (AOR, 2.3; 95% CI, 1.1-6.2; p = 0.0317) are independent risk factors. CONCLUSIONS: In the general population, 62.1% had fatty liver, and NAFLD prevalence was twice as high as previously reported. Screening that is noninvasive, low-cost, and does not require special techniques or equipment is needed to detect advanced liver fibrosis.

BACKGROUND: Low birth weight (LBW) is a major factor of neonate mortality that particularly affects developing countries. However, the scarcity of data to support decision making to reduce LBW occurrence is a major obstacle in sub-Saharan Africa. The aim of this research was to determine the prevalence and associated factors of LBW at the Yako health district in a rural area of Burkina Faso. METHODS: A cross sectional survey was conducted at four peripheral health centers among mothers and their newly delivered babies. The mothers' socio-demographic and obstetrical characteristics were collected by face-to-face interview or by review of antenatal care books. Maternal malaria was tested by standard microscopy and neonates' birth weights were documented. Multivariate logistic regression was used to determine factors associated with LBW. A p-value < 0.05 was considered statistically significant. RESULTS: Of 600 neonates examined, the prevalence of low birth weight was 11.0%. Adjustment for socio-demographic characteristic, medical conditions, obstetrical history, malaria prevention measures by multivariate logistic regression found that being a primigravid mother (aOR = 1.8, [95% CI: 1.1-3.0]), the presence of malaria infection (aOR = 1.9, [95% CI: 1.1-3.5]), the uptake of less than three doses of sulfadoxine-pyrimethamine for the intermittent preventive treatment of malaria in pregnancy (IPTp-SP) (aOR = 2.2, [95% CI: 1.3-3.9]), the presence of maternal fever at the time of delivery (aOR = 2.8, [95% CI: 1.5-5.3]) and being a female neonate (aOR = 1.9, [95% CI: 1.1-3.3]) were independently associated with an increased risk of LBW occurrence. The number of antenatal visits performed by the mother during her pregnancy did not provide any direct protection for low birth weight. CONCLUSION: The prevalence of LBW remained high in the study area. Maternal malaria, fever and low uptake of sulfadoxine-pyrimethamine doses were significantly associated with LBW and should be adequately addressed by public health interventions.

BACKGROUND: This longitudinal study aimed to determine chronological changes in the seroprevalence of prior SARS-CoV-2 infection, including asymptomatic infections in Hiroshima Prefecture, Japan. METHODS: A stratified random sample of 7,500 residents from five cities of Hiroshima Prefecture was selected to participate in a three-round survey from late 2020 to early 2021, before the introduction of the COVID-19 vaccine. The seroprevalence of anti-SARS-CoV-2 antibodies was calculated if at least two of four commercially available immunoassays were positive. Then, the ratio between seroprevalence and the prevalence of confirmed COVID-19 cases in Hiroshima was calculated and compared to the results from other prefectures where the Ministry of Health, Labour and Welfare conducted a survey by using the same reagents at almost the same period. RESULTS: The numbers of participants in the first, second, and third rounds of the survey were 3025, 2396, and 2351, respectively and their anti-SARS-CoV-2 antibodies seroprevalences were 0.03% (95% confidence interval: 0.00-0.10%), 0.08% (0.00-0.20%), and 0.30% (0.08-0.52%), respectively. The ratio between the seroprevalence and the prevalence of confirmed COVID-19 cases in Hiroshima was 1.2, which was smaller than that in similar studies in other prefectures. CONCLUSIONS: The seroprevalence of anti-SARS-CoV-2 antibodies in Hiroshima increased tenfold in a half year. The difference between seroprevalence and the prevalence of confirmed COVID-19 cases in Hiroshima was smaller than that in other prefectures, suggesting that asymptomatic patients were more actively detected in Hiroshima.

BACKGROUND & AIMS: The relationship between the frequency of drinking and fatty liver in the general population is still poorly understood. This study analysed data from a large cohort who underwent health checkups in Japan between 2008 and 2019 to investigate the prevalence and incidence of fatty liver by alcohol consumption and risk factors for fatty liver. METHODS: The prevalence of fatty liver diagnosed with ultrasonography was calculated in 75,670 residents. The incidence of fatty liver in 31,062 residents who underwent ultrasonography at least twice during the period without fatty liver at the first time was calculated using the person-year method. Multivariate logistic analysis was performed to investigate risk factors associated with the prevalence and incidence of fatty liver. RESULTS: The prevalence of fatty liver was 27.6% (95% confidence interval [CI], 27.2-27.9) in non-drinkers, 28.5% (27.5-29.5) in moderate-drinkers and 28.0% (26.0-29.9) in heavy-drinkers. The incidence of fatty liver was 3,084/100,000 person-years (2,997-3,172/100,000) in non-drinkers, 3,754/100,000 person-years (3,481-4,042/100,000) in moderate-drinkers and 3,861/100,000 person-years (3,295-4,497/100,000) in heavy-drinkers. The prevalence and incidence of fatty liver were not associated with drinking status. Obesity was the most important independent risk factor (prevalence: adjusted odds ratio [AOR], 6.3; 95% CI, 6.0-6.5; incidence: AOR, 2.4; 95% CI, 2.3-2.6). CONCLUSIONS: Drinking status does not affect the prevalence or incidence of fatty liver in Japanese residents undergoing health checkups. From a public health perspective, measures for obesity control must be prioritised to reduce the burden of disease of fatty liver in Japan.

BACKGROUND: For uncomplicated Plasmodium falciparum malaria, highly efficacious single-dose treatments are expected to increase compliance and improve treatment outcomes, and thereby may slow the development of resistance. The efficacy and safety of a single-dose combination of artefenomel (800 mg) plus ferroquine (400/600/900/1200 mg doses) for the treatment of uncomplicated P. falciparum malaria were evaluated in Africa (focusing on children ≤ 5 years) and Asia. METHODS: The study was a randomized, double-blind, single-dose, multi-arm clinical trial in patients aged > 6 months to < 70 years, from six African countries and Vietnam. Patients were followed up for 63 days to assess treatment efficacy, safety and pharmacokinetics. The primary efficacy endpoint was the polymerase chain reaction (PCR)-adjusted adequate clinical and parasitological response (ACPR) at Day 28 in the Per-Protocol [PP] Set comprising only African patients ≤ 5 years. The exposure-response relationship for PCR-adjusted ACPR at Day 28 and prevalence of kelch-13 mutations were explored. RESULTS: A total of 373 patients were treated: 289 African patients ≤ 5 years (77.5%), 64 African patients > 5 years and 20 Asian patients. None of the treatment arms met the target efficacy criterion for PCR-adjusted ACPR at Day 28 (lower limit of 95% confidence interval [CI] > 90%). PCR-adjusted ACPR at Day 28 [95% CI] in the PP Set ranged from 78.4% [64.7; 88.7%] to 91.7% [81.6; 97.2%] for the 400 mg to 1200 mg ferroquine dose. Efficacy rates were low in Vietnamese patients, ranging from 20 to 40%. A clear relationship was found between drug exposure (artefenomel and ferroquine concentrations at Day 7) and efficacy (primary endpoint), with higher concentrations of both drugs resulting in higher efficacy. Six distinct kelch-13 mutations were detected in parasite isolates from 10/272 African patients (with 2 mutations known to be associated with artemisinin resistance) and 18/20 Asian patients (all C580Y mutation). Vomiting within 6 h of initial artefenomel administration was common (24.6%) and associated with lower drug exposures. CONCLUSION: The efficacy of artefenomel/ferroquine combination was suboptimal in African children aged ≤ 5 years, the population of interest, and vomiting most likely had a negative impact on efficacy. BACKGROUND: Detailed characteristics of Hepatitis C virus (HCV) infection in Burkina Faso are scarce. The main aim of this study was to assess HCV seroprevalence in various settings and populations at risk in Burkina Faso between 1990 and 2020. Secondary objectives included the prevalence of HCV Ribonucleic acid (RNA) and the distribution of HCV genotypes. METHODS: A systematic database search, supplemented by a manual search, was conducted in PubMed, Web of Science, Scopus, and African Index Medicus. Studies reporting HCV seroprevalence data in low and high-risk populations in Burkina Faso were included, and a random-effects meta-analysis was applied. Risk of bias was assessed using the Joanna Briggs institute checklist. RESULTS: Low-risk populations were examined in 31 studies involving a total of 168,151 subjects, of whom 8330 were positive for HCV antibodies. Six studies included a total of 1484 high-risk persons, and 96 had antibodies to HCV. The pooled seroprevalence in low-risk populations was 3.72% (95% CI: 3.20-4.28) and 4.75% (95% CI: 1.79-8.94) in high-risk groups. A non-significant decreasing trend was observed over the study period. Seven studies tested HCV RNA in a total of 4759 individuals at low risk for HCV infection, and 81 were positive. The meta-analysis of HCV RNA yielded a pooled prevalence of 1.65% (95% CI: 0.74-2.89%) in low-risk populations, which is assumed to be indicative of HCV prevalence in the general population of Burkina Faso and suggests that about 301,174 people are active HCV carriers in the country. Genotypes 2 and 1 were the most frequent, with 60.3% and 25.0%, respectively. CONCLUSIONS: HCV seroprevalence is intermediate in Burkina Faso and indicates the need to implement effective control strategies. There is a paucity of data at the national level and for rural and high-risk populations. General population screening and linkage to care are recommended, with special attention to rural and high-risk populations.

BACKGROUND: This study sought to provide up-to-date hepatitis B (HBV) and C (HCV) seroprevalence in rural Burkina Faso decade after hepatitis B vaccine was introduced in the national immunization scheduled for children. METHODS: In 2018, a community-based, random sampling strategy with probability proportional to population size was conducted in Nanoro to investigate the prevalence of viral hepatitis in children and their mothers. Sociodemographic, vaccination history and risk factors were assessed by interview and health books. HBsAg rapid tests were done by finger prick and Dried Blood Spots (DBS) were collected for hepatitis seromarkers by chemiluminescence enzyme immunoassay. Positive samples underwent confirmatory PCR and phylogenetic analysis. RESULTS: Data were presented on 240 mother-child pairs. HBsAg Prevalence was 0.8% in children and 6.3% in mothers. Hepatitis B core antibody positivity was 89.2% in mothers, 59.2% in children and was associated with age, sex and scarification. Hepatitis B surface antibodies prevalence was 37.5% in children and 5.8% in mothers. Good vaccination coverage was limited by home delivery. Phylogenetic analysis of HBV strains based on full genome sequences (n = 7) and s-fragment sequences (n = 6) revealed genotype A, E, and recombinant A3/E. Viral genome homology was reported in one mother-child pair. Anti-HCV prevalence was 5.4% in mothers, 2.1% in children and strains belonged to genotype 2. CONCLUSIONS: In Nanoro, HBsAg prevalence was low in children, intermediate in mothers and mother-to-child transmission persists. Home delivery was a limiting factor of Hepatitis B vaccination coverage. HBV genotype E was predominant and genotype A3/E is reported for the first time in Burkina Faso.

BACKGROUND: Today, the development of new and well-tolerated anti-malarial drugs is strongly justified by the emergence of Plasmodium falciparum resistance. In 2014-2015, a phase 2b clinical study was conducted to evaluate the efficacy of a single oral dose of Artefenomel (OZ439)-piperaquine (PPQ) in Asian and African patients presenting with uncomplicated falciparum malaria. METHODS: Blood samples collected before treatment offered the opportunity to investigate the proportion of multidrug resistant parasite genotypes, including P. falciparum kelch13 mutations and copy number variation of both P. falciparum plasmepsin 2 (Pfpm2) and P. falciparum multidrug resistance 1 (Pfmdr1) genes. RESULTS: Validated kelch13 resistance mutations including C580Y, I543T, P553L and V568G were only detected in parasites from Vietnamese patients. In Africa, isolates with multiple copies of the Pfmdr1 gene were shown to be more frequent than previously reported (21.1%, range from 12.4% in Burkina Faso to 27.4% in Uganda). More strikingly, high proportions of isolates with multiple copies of the Pfpm2 gene, associated with piperaquine (PPQ) resistance, were frequently observed in the African sites, especially in Burkina Faso and Uganda (> 30%). CONCLUSIONS: These findings were considered to sharply contrast with the recent description of increased sensitivity to PPQ of Ugandan parasite isolates. This emphasizes the necessity to investigate in vitro susceptibility profiles to PPQ of African isolates with multiple copies of the Pfpm2 gene and estimate the risk of development of PPQ resistance in Africa. BACKGROUND: Hepatitis B virus (HBV) infection was long considered an important public health concern in Burkina Faso and still represents a major cause of liver cancer and cirrhosis in the active population. To counter the problem, a national strategic plan was developed and adopted in July 2017 to coordinate viral hepatitis elimination's efforts. However evidence to support its implementation remains scanty and scattered. The main purpose of this study was to summarize available information from per-reviewed articles published over the last two decades to accurately estimate the prevalence of HBV infection in Burkina Faso. METHODS: We conducted a systematic search with meta-analysis of scientific articles using Science-Direct, Web-of-Science, PubMed/Medline, and Google Scholar. We systematically assessed all relevant publications that measured the prevalence of hepatitis B surface antigen and which were published between 1996 and 2017. We estimated the national HBV prevalence and its 95% confident interval. We subsequently adjusted the meta-analysis to possible sources of heterogeneity. RESULTS: We retrieved and analyzed a total of 22 full text papers including 99,672 participants. The overall prevalence was 11.21%. The prevalence after adjustment were 9.41%, 11.11%, 11.73% and 12.61% in the general population, pregnant women, blood donors and HIV-positive persons respectively. The prevalence was higher before implementation of HBV universal vaccination and decreased from 12.80% between 1996 and 2001 to 11.11% between 2012 and 2017. The prevalence was also higher in rural area 17.35% than urban area 11.11%. The western regions were more affected with 12.69% than the central regions 10.57%. The prevalence was 14.66% in the boucle of Mouhoun region and 14.59 in the center-west region. Aggregate data were not available for the other regions. CONCLUSIONS: HBV has clearly an important burden in Burkina Faso as described by its high prevalence and this problem significantly challenges the national health care system. There is an urgent need for effective public health interventions to eliminate the problem. However, higher quality data are needed to produce reliable epidemiological estimates that will guide control efforts towards the achievement of the national strategic plan's goals.

BACKGROUND: This study aimed to compare the performance of Sanger-based SARS-CoV-2 spike gene sequencing and Next Generation Sequencing (NGS)-based full-genome sequencing for variant identification in saliva samples with low viral titer. METHODS: Using 241 stocked saliva samples collected from confirmed COVID-19 patients between November 2020 and March 2022 in Hiroshima, SARS-CoV-2 spike gene sequencing (nt22735-nt23532) was performed by nested RT-PCR and Sanger platform using in-house primers. The same samples underwent full-genome sequencing by NGS using Illumina NextSeq2000. RESULTS: Among 241 samples, 147 were amplified by both the Sanger and the Illumina NextSeq2000 NGS, 86 by Sanger only, and 8 were not amplified at all. The overall amplification rates of Illumina NextSeq2000 NGS and Sanger were 61% and 96.7%, respectively. At low viral titer (< 103 copies/mL), Illumina NextSeq2000 NGS provided 19.2% amplification, while Sanger was 89.7% (p < 0.0001). Both platforms identified 38 wild type, 54 Alpha variants, 84 Delta variants, and 57 Omicron variants. CONCLUSIONS: Our study provided evidence to expand the capacity of Sanger-based SARS-CoV-2 spike gene sequencing for variants identification over full-genome by Illumina NextSeq2000 NGS for mass screening. Therefore, the feasible and simple Sanger-based SARS-CoV-2 spike gene sequencing is practical for the initial variants screening, which might reduce the gap between the rapid evolution of SARS-CoV-2 and its molecular surveillance.

In highly endemic countries for hepatitis B virus (HBV) infection, childhood infection, including mother-to-child transmission (MTCT), represents the primary transmission route. High maternal DNA level (viral load ≥ 200,000 IU/mL) is a significant factor for MTCT. We investigated the prevalence of HBsAg, HBeAg, and high HBV DNA among pregnant women in three hospitals in Burkina Faso and assessed the performance of HBeAg to predict high viral load. Consenting pregnant women were interviewed on their sociodemographic characteristics and tested for HBsAg by a rapid diagnostic test, and dried blood spot (DBS) samples were collected for laboratory analyses. Of the 1622 participants, HBsAg prevalence was 6.5% (95% CI, 5.4-7.8%). Among 102 HBsAg-positive pregnant women in DBS samples, HBeAg was positive in 22.6% (95% CI, 14.9-31.9%), and viral load was quantified in 94 cases, with 19.1% having HBV DNA ≥ 200,000 IU/mL. HBV genotypes were identified in 63 samples and predominant genotypes were E (58.7%) and A (36.5%). The sensitivity of HBeAg by using DBS samples to identify high viral load in the 94 cases was 55.6%, and the specificity was 86.8%. These findings highlight the need to implement routine HBV screening and effective MTCT risk assessment for all pregnant women in Burkina Faso to enable early interventions that can effectively reduce MTCT.

Background: Determining the number of chronic hepatitis B (HBV) and C virus (HCV) infections is essential to assess the progress towards the World Health Organization 2030 viral hepatitis elimination goals. Using data from the Japanese National Database (NDB), we calculated the number of chronic HBV and HCV infections in 2015 and predicted the trend until 2035. Methods: NDB and first-time blood donors data were used to calculate the number of chronic HBV and HCV infections in 2015. A Markov simulation was applied to predict chronic infections until 2035 using transition probabilities calculated from NDB data. Findings: The total number of chronic HBV and HCV infections in 2015 in Japan was 1,905,187-2,490,873 (HCV:877,841-1,302,179, HBV:1,027,346-1,188,694), of which 923,661-1,509,347 were undiagnosed or diagnosed but not linked to care ("not engaged in care"), and 981,526 were engaged in care. Chronic HBV and HCV infections are expected to be 923,313-1,304,598 in 2030, and 739,118-1,045,884 in 2035. Compared to 2015, by 2035, the number of persons with HCV not engaged in care will decline by 59·8 - 76·1% and 86·5% for patients in care. For HBV, a 47·3 - 49·3% decrease is expected for persons not engaged in care and a decline of 26·0% for patients engaged in care. Interpretation: Although the burden of HBV and HCV is expected to decrease by 2035, challenges in controlling hepatitis remain. Improved and innovative screening strategies with linkage to care for HCV cases, and a functional cure for HBV are needed. Funding: Japan Ministry of Health, Labour and Welfare.

BACKGROUND: The WHO recommends continuous surveillance of malaria in endemic countries to identify areas and populations most in need for targeted interventions. The aim of this study was to assess the prevalence of malaria and its associated factors among first antenatal care (ANC) attendees in rural Burkina Faso. METHODS: A cross-sectional survey was conducted between August 2019 and September 2020 at the Yako health district and included 1067 first ANC attendees. Sociodemographic, gyneco-obstetric, and medical characteristics were collected. Malaria was diagnosed by standard microscopy and hemoglobin level was measured by spectrophotometry. A multivariate logistic regression analysis was used to identify factors associated with malaria infection. RESULTS: Overall malaria infection prevalence was 16.1% (167/1039). Among malaria-positive women, the geometric mean parasite density was 1204 [95% confidence interval (CI) 934-1552] parasites/µL and the proportion of very low (1-199 parasites/µL), low (200-999 parasites/µL), medium (1000-9999 parasites/µL) and high (≥ 10,000 parasites/µL) parasite densities were 15.0%, 35.3%, 38.3% and 11.4%, respectively. Age < 20 years (adjusted odds ratio (aOR): 2.2; 95% CI 1.4-3.5), anemia (hemoglobin < 11 g/deciliter) (aOR: 3.4; 95% CI 2.2-5.5), the non-use of bed net (aOR: 1.8; 95% CI 1.1-2.8), and the absence of intermittent preventive treatment with sulfadoxine-pyrimethamine (aOR: 5.8; 95% CI 2.1-24.5) were positively associated with malaria infection. CONCLUSIONS: The study showed that one out of six pregnant women had a microscopy-detected P. falciparum malaria infection at their first ANC visit. Strengthening malaria prevention strategies during the first ANC visit is needed to prevent unfavorable birth outcomes.

BACKGROUND: Hepatitis B virus (HBV) infection is one of the major public health problems globally as well as in Cambodia. Continuous information on HBV infection burden is required to implement effective disease control strategies. This study aimed to determine the prevalence and genotype distribution of HBV infection in Cambodia through a systematic review with meta-analysis. METHODS: Four databases (PubMed, Web of Science, Scopus, and Google Scholar) were used to search published studies reporting either HBV prevalence or genotype distribution in Cambodia until August 21, 2020. Reviews, modeling studies, and studies conducted among Cambodian permanently living abroad were excluded. The Freeman-Tukey double arcsine transformation was implemented to achieve approximate normality. The DerSimonian and Laird method was used to compute pooled estimates based on the transformed values and their variance. Possible publication bias was assessed by the Egger test and the funnel plot. RESULTS: A total of 22 studies were included, covering 22,323 people. Ten studies reported HBV prevalence in the general population. The HBV infection prevalence was 4.73% (95%CI: 2.75-7.17%) in the general population and 19.87% (95%CI: 10.95-30.63%) in high-risk/co-infected groups. By sub-group analysis, the prevalence was 6.81% (95% CI: 4.43-9.66) in adults older than 15 years old, 2.37% (95% CI:0.04-7.05) in children 6-15 years old, and 2.47% (95% CI: 0.96-4.59) in children less than five years old. The prevalence of HBV infection decreased over time. Predominant HBV genotypes were genotypes C and B with 82.96% and 16.79%, respectively. CONCLUSIONS: The decrease in HBV infection prevalence in Cambodia demonstrates the effects of national hepatitis B immunization, improved clinical hygiene, and the use of disposable devices. However, the estimated HBV prevalence among the general population indicates an intermediate endemicity level of HBV infection. Therefore, population screening and linkage to care, high vaccination coverage, health promotion, and HBV surveillance are essential to meet the WHO 2030 goal.
